These orange vegetables contain beta-carotene, which acts as a natural sunscreen from within, protecting skin cells from sun exposure.
Rich in lycopene, tomatoes provide protection against sun damage and may prevent wrinkling. Cooking tomatoes with olive oil increases lycopene absorption.
Packed with vitamin C, bell peppers support collagen production. One red bell pepper contains more vitamin C than an orange!
Blueberries, strawberries, and blackberries are loaded with antioxidants and vitamin C, which fight free radicals and support skin structure.

How quickly can dietary changes improve my skin? While some people notice improvements within 2-3 weeks, significant changes typically require 8-12 weeks of consistent dietary habits as your skin completes its natural renewal cycle.
Can food really help with acne? Yes! Anti-inflammatory foods like fatty fish and antioxidant-rich berries can help reduce acne inflammation, while reducing dairy and high-glycemic foods may decrease breakouts for many people.
What's the single most important nutritional change for better skin? Increasing your intake of colorful fruits and vegetables is perhaps the most impactful change, as they provide a spectrum of ant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als that support multiple aspects of skin health.
